Prepare to be immersed in the rich, soulful sounds of Cocoa Tea's upcoming album, "Room In My Father's House," set to release on September 26, 2025, under the Reggae Library label. This highly anticipated collection spans a diverse range of genres, including lovers rock, reggae, ragga, roots reggae, and dancehall, offering a comprehensive journey through the evolution of these iconic sounds.
With a runtime of over two hours, this album is a testament to Cocoa Tea's enduring artistry and his ability to craft timeless music that resonates with audiences worldwide. The tracklist is a blend of introspective ballads, upbeat anthems, and thought-provoking lyrics, showcasing Cocoa Tea's versatility and depth as an artist.
From the reflective "Why Is It Taking So Long" to the energetic "Fire No Guns," and the heartfelt "If I Could," each track tells a story, inviting you to connect with the music on a personal level. The album also features standout collaborations, such as the "Father's House - Brawta Mix" and "Room In My Father's House - Grafton Allstars Mix," adding a fresh twist to the classic sounds.
Cocoa Tea's distinctive voice and lyrical prowess shine through in tracks like "Monday Morning Blues," "Street Wise," and "Your Mama," offering a glimpse into his unique perspective on life, love, and societal issues. The album's title track, "Room In My Father's House," serves as a poignant reminder of the importance of family and heritage, themes that are woven throughout the collection.
